Caregiver Support
Our Caregiver Support Center provides a place to relax, have a complimentary snack and drink, or communicate with family and friends via the Caregiver Center laptop or phone. There also is a helpful and caring volunteer present, and a resource wall which connects caregivers to support groups and services. Our focus is reaching out to and supporting family caregivers. There are also enhanced benefits for certain eligible caregivers of enrolled veterans. The sole purpose of our program is to meet physical and emotional needs of the family members of our patients.

Services for Family Caregivers of Veterans
The Program of Comprehensive Assistance for Family Caregivers (PCAFC) is expanding to all eras.
Expansion rolls out in two phases beginning with eligible Veterans who served on or before May 7, 1975, and phase two, beginning October 1, 2022, will include eligible Veterans who served between May 7, 1975, and September 11, 2001.
PCAFC, which prior to this expansion was only available for eligible Post-9/11 Veterans who incurred or aggravated a serious injury in the line of duty, provides resources, education, support, a financial stipend, health insurance, and beneficiary travel to caregivers of eligible Veterans.
Veterans with a 70% service-connected disability who served either on or after September 11, 2001, or on or before May 7, 1975, and are in need of Caregivers Support should contact their local Caregivers Support Coordinator, or visit https://www.caregiver.va.gov for more information.
